Nothing OS 4.0 coming soon with new features, Good news for nothing users

Nothing has officially revealed Nothing OS 4.0, its next big update based on Android 16, bringing a suite of visual refinements, privacy enhancements, and usability updates.

What’s New in Nothing OS 4.0

1. Refined User Interface

  • Lock screen clocks have been reimagined to be more elegant and consistent.
  • Quick Settings has a cleaner and more standardized tile layout.
  • Overall design looks more fluid less clutter more clarity in visual hierarchy.

2. Extra Dark Mode

  • An enhancement over the current dark theme this mode pushes toward true black tones aimed at reducing eye strain and saving battery especially on OLED displays.

3. Multitasking and app optimizations

  • Introduction of a Pop-up View feature: run two floating app windows, switch between them, minimise or expand with simple gestures.
  • General app optimization: faster start times, smoother performance across basic interactions.

4. Upgraded camera and gallery

A revamped TrueLens Engine underpins the camera and gallery improvements new creative presets more intuitive control layouts smarter gallery features.

5. AI Transparency and Control

  • A key focus is making AI more visible: there will be status hints for when AI / large language models are in use.
  • New AI usage dashboard and usage trends to show which AI features or models are active.

6. Other System Improvements

  • Lock screen and always-on display responsiveness improved.
  • Refined brightness controls enhanced bluetooth and Wi-Fi stability.
  • Smoother transitions and more stable behaviour overall.

Nothing OS 4.0 rollout and availability

  • The update is based on Android 16.
  • Nothing will begin an open beta program soon letting users test out OS 4.0 before full public release.
  • Phones eligible include most Nothing devices, though older or end oflife models may be excluded.

Why nothing OS 4.0 is important for user?

  • User Control and Privacy: With AI usage becoming more ubiquitous in modern OS features, the transparency is a welcome move. It helps users know when AI is active which models are being used and how much.
